"The Greek Islands. I have been to all of the island groups and continue to explore them. My love affair with Greece began when I was 18 and, though the holiday romances have come and gone, my love for the islands only continues to grow. I also love our little house on the beach in north Wexford, built by my grandfather and now shared equally between his children and 13 grandchildren. It's my soul space."
"Abbeyglen Castle in Clifden for the atmosphere Brian Hughes continues to create year after year - warm, friendly, unexpected and hospitality that's hard to match anywhere else in Ireland. Paris is one of my favourite cities. I love cycling around the city visiting the preloved designer clothes shops scattered from the Marais to Montmartre."
